Harry "Tiny" Hill was anything but; standing at 350-plus pounds, this cornball bandleader had a string of hits during the '40s. This collection of World transcriptions, cut at the Melody Mill Ballroom in Chicago, includes his theme song, Angry; Five Foot Two, Eyes of Blue; How Many Hearts Have You Broken; My Old Kentucky Home; I'm Looking Over a Four Leaf Clover; Am I Blue?; Turkey in the Straw, and more. 25 tunes!
